Nevada Code § 539.417

Assumption of operation and maintenance of existing works only; power of local board to levy assessments and impose tolls and charges

Where it is proposed that a division assume
only the operation and maintenance of the existing works, the contract for the
operation and maintenance of the existing works must be submitted to the
electors of the division for approval at a special election or the next
district election or primary or general state election. The local board of
directors, after the contract is made in pursuance of the authority granted in
the election, may levy assessments or impose tolls and charges annually or
otherwise to raise the amounts necessary to carry out the contract and to
operate and maintain the works, including amounts to be paid to the United
States pursuant to the contract, in the same manner and to the same effect as
may be done by the board of directors of the district under the provisions of this
chapter.
